Adding Objects to a Form<br />

754<br />

The Validate Form dialog appears.<br />

4. In the Validate Form dialog, click the Form tab.<br />

5. In the Label style and Field style drop-down lists, select a style for the<br />

appearance of form labels and fields that do not meet validation requirements.<br />

To create a new style, choose Manage Styles. See “Creating a Text Style” on<br />

page 203.<br />

• To apply the label style to all labels on the form that do not meet validation<br />

requirements, click the Apply to all labels button.<br />

• To apply the field style to all labels on the form that do not meet validation<br />

requirements, click the Apply to all fields button.<br />

6. Customize error message text for selected validation options by replacing the<br />

default Error Message text in the Validate From dialog.<br />

7. Click the Show only first error check list to show only the first error when<br />

multiple validation errors have been made.<br />

When a visitor submits the form after correcting the first error, the remaining<br />

errors will displayed sequentially until each error has been corrected.<br />

8. Click OK to close the Validate Form dialog.
